Green Springs Highway in Homewood has become one of Birmingham’s most diverse food corridors, offering everything from Chinese, Yemeni and Middle Eastern cuisine to Mexican, Salvadoran, Latin American and Southern comfort food—all within just a few miles.

Read on for some local spots worth checking out, in no particular order.

1. Los Valedores Restaurant

Ask any local, and they’ll probably tell you that Los Valedores has some of the best street tacos around. The longtime taco truck off Green Springs recently opened up its first brick-and-mortar at the same location, with an expanded menu featuring quesabirria, elote and more Mexican classics.

Tip: You can also find Los Valedores’ truck at Good People Brewing across from Regions Field—the perfect pre-baseball meal!

2. Hometown Supermarket + Mr. Chen’s

Part international grocery store, part culinary destination, this Homewood favorite features more than 100,000 products from around the world. Inside, Mr. Chen’s serves authentic Chinese dishes ranging from hand-pulled noodles and dumplings to traditional Sichuan specialties. 

Tip: Got any gluten-free friends? Mr. Chen’s menu offers a wide range of celiac-friendly options.

3. Maya Mexican Restaurant

Known for its lively atmosphere and extensive Tex-Mex menu, Maya serves crowd-pleasers like fajitas, enchiladas, chimichangas, burritos and house margaritas. It’s a popular gathering spot for lunch, dinner and fiestas of all kinds!

4. Bayt al Qahwah

This cozy Middle Eastern café specializes in traditional Arabic coffee, tea drinks, desserts and pastries. They also carry unique treats, like the viral frozen fruit ice cream that’s been all over our feeds.

5. Mandi Oasis

One of Birmingham’s newest international dining destinations, Mandi Oasis specializes in traditional Yemeni cuisine. Signature dishes include chicken mandi, slow-roasted lamb, fahsah and fragrant rice platters designed for sharing—so either come hungry, or come with a friend!

6. The Purple Onion Deli & Grill

The Homewood Purple Onion is still run by the original owners, and has been since 1991. (Grace Howard / Bham Now)

A longtime Birmingham staple and a local late-night favorite, the original Purple Onion offers an expansive menu that blends Mediterranean and American favorites.

Expect gyros, grilled chicken plates, Greek salads, burgers, sandwiches and much more. (Not for nothing, but the chicken fingers are really good too.)

7. Acapulco Mexican Restaurant

A neighborhood favorite for authentic Mexican fare, Acapulco serves traditional tacos, enchiladas, quesadillas and combination plates—don’t skip the margaritas.

8. La Tia Poisa Taco Shop

This casual taqueria may be tiny, but its flavors are mighty—La Tia Poisa Taco Shop known for street-style tacos, tortas, burritos and authentic Mexican flavors. It’s a popular stop for quick, affordable meals.

Tip: La Tia Poisa Taco Shop is also open for breakfast! Stop by for a tasty Mexican style coffee and a breakfast burrito.

9. Mi Pueblo Greensprings

Mi Pueblo combines a massive Hispanic grocery market with a restaurant offering tacos, tamales, grilled meats, salsas and fresh breads. If you’re making your own tacos, you’re going to want to hit up Mi Pueblo for the best tortillas, spices and meat selection around.

10. Marielo’s Pupuseria

A hidden gem for Salvadoran cuisine, Marielo’s specializes in handmade pupusas stuffed with cheese, beans, pork and other fillings, along with traditional Central American dishes.

11. Sabor Latino

Offering flavors from Peru and across Latin America, Sabor Latino serves hearty plates featuring grilled meats, rice dishes, empanadas and other regional favorites. Fan favorites include the Peruvian tamales and fresh passion fruit juice.

12. Paw Paw Patch

Serving Southern comfort food for decades, Paw Paw Patch is a beloved for its weekday meat-and-three offerings, fried okra, squash casserole, cornbread and classic homestyle sides—my favorite has to be the fried green tomatoes!
